I usually don't even bother reading most sales letters from marketers I have grown to trust like Reese. I just see what they are offering, check the price and then order.
However, I did read that sales letter and it was a fantastic one! Some of the elements that he used that I noticed were as follows:
1. Establishes a good introductory story. People love stories and stories sell like crazy.
2. Uses fear as a motivator. I use this one myself and I can tell you it's very powerful.
3. Bullet Point benefits. If people are going to spend money, they want to know what they are getting. One of the best ways to communicate this is by using the classic bullet point benefit technique.
4. Establishes his expertise. Although many of us already know why he's as good as he is, you would be surprised how many people have never heard of John Reese. So it's always a good idea to establish your expertise and credentials so people will understand why they should listen to what you have to say.
5. Price. The price is brilliant. It is high enough to keep the "tirespinners" out, but low enough that the serious marketers are going to look at it and say this is a no brainer. For one of my main products, that's only five sales a month. December was a terrible month for me, but even in December, I've made a lot more than 5 sales and quite frankly the only reason why is because of ONE technique I learned from John Reese.
6. Money Back Guarantee. Money back guarantees do a great job at closing people who are on the fence. It takes the risk away because you get to try the product out and if you don't like it, you get your money back. It also establishes more credibility because it shows the seller is willing to put "his money where his mouth is" so to speak.
7. Accepts credit card and paypal. God bless John Reese for accepting paypal! I don't know about anybody else, but I'm much more likely to make a purchase if the buyer accepts paypal because I can pay for it directly out my profits, as oppose to putting it on a credit card and having to worry about paying for it later. It just makes things a lot easier.
8. Limited Memberships. I started using this technqiue and I saw my opt in rates increase at least 20%, if not more! People don't like to miss out on anything and if you cap it at a certain amount, they are more likely to act now instead of later. The only thing I would have done differently is list the number of charter memberships I plan to sell. He may not have decided yet, but I would have listed it and then made updates periodically to really get people to close.
